Joyce A. Granade went to her heavenly home Tuesday, May 28, 2024, at the age of 91. A Frisco, Texas resident and Davenport, Iowa native, she was born on October 20, 1932, and was the only child of the late Louis and Lydia (Klewin) Rahn.

Joyce graduated from Geneseo High School in Geneseo, Illinois and attended Augustana College (Rock Island, Illinois) and Moline Lutheran Hospital School of Nursing (Moline, Illinois) where she graduated with a registered nursing degree in 1954. She went on to have a 42-year career in nursing in which she thrived as a clinical educational coordinator.

She is survived by two daughters; Jerris (Mark) Ruth of Ft. Loudon, Pennsylvania; Marcia (David) Wehrle of Oak Point, Texas; and son Gregg Granade of Frisco, Texas. Grandchildren Collette Dziemian of Bealeton, Virginia; Shaun (Jessica) Collins of Washington, D.C.; Erica Wehrle (Conner Crisafulli) of Tampa, Florida and great-granddaughter Gwendolyn Dziemian of Bealeton, Virginia. She is also survived by the father of her children; O.H. Granade of McMinnville, Tennessee.

Joyce was a devoted mother, grandmother and friend.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made in her name to Prince of Peace Lutheran Church, Carrollton, Texas where she was a member.
